Design and Build Quality: A Masterclass in Premium Portability

Razer has consistently set a high bar for laptop design, and the Blade 14 2023 continues this tradition with aplomb.

It’s an exercise in understated elegance combined with robust construction, making it one of the most aesthetically pleasing and durable compact gaming laptops on the market.

Chassis and Materials

The chassis is crafted from a single block of CNC-milled aluminum, giving it an undeniable premium feel and exceptional rigidity.

You won’t find much flex here, even when trying to twist the lid or press down on the keyboard deck.

This attention to detail in material selection contributes significantly to its longevity and perceived quality.

  • Matte Black Finish: The signature matte black anodized finish is sleek and absorbs fingerprints better than glossy alternatives, though it’s not entirely immune. It gives the laptop a professional look that fits seamlessly into various environments.
  • Minimalist Aesthetic: Unlike many gaming laptops that scream “gamer” with aggressive lines and excessive RGB, the Blade 14 maintains a clean, minimalist profile. The only obvious gaming flourish is the backlit Razer logo on the lid, which can be customized via Razer Synapse.
  • Slim Profile: At just 0.67 inches 16.99 mm thick, it’s remarkably slender for a gaming machine packing this much power. This contributes to its impressive portability, allowing it to slip easily into most backpacks and messenger bags.

Portability and Weight

This is where the Blade 14 truly shines.

Its dimensions and weight make it an ideal companion for those who need high-performance computing on the go.

  • Lightweight for its Class: Weighing in at approximately 4.05 lbs 1.84 kg, it’s not the absolute lightest 14-inch laptop, but it’s incredibly light for a gaming machine equipped with high-end discrete graphics. This weight distribution feels balanced, making it comfortable to carry.
  • Compact Footprint: The small form factor means it takes up minimal desk space and is easy to use in tighter environments, such as airplane tray tables or small coffee shop tables.
  • Travel-Friendly Power Adapter: While not tiny, Razer’s power adapters are relatively compact compared to some other gaming laptop bricks, further enhancing its travel readiness.

Hinge and Screen Stability

The hinge design is robust and allows for smooth, one-handed opening.

The screen exhibits minimal wobble, even when typing vigorously or if the laptop is jostled.

Display Excellence: Visuals That Pop

The display on the Razer Blade 14 2023 is a significant highlight, offering a fantastic balance of resolution, refresh rate, and color accuracy, catering to both gamers and creative professionals.

Panel Specifications

Razer opted for a QHD+ 2560×1600 resolution IPS panel with a rapid 240Hz refresh rate.

This combination is arguably the sweet spot for a 14-inch gaming laptop, providing crisp visuals without being overly taxing on the GPU, unlike 4K panels.

  • Resolution and Aspect Ratio: The 2560×1600 resolution on a 14-inch screen results in a high pixel density, making text sharp and images detailed. The 16:10 aspect ratio provides more vertical screen real estate than traditional 16:9 displays, which is beneficial for productivity tasks like coding, document editing, and web browsing.
  • Response Time: While an exact response time isn’t always published, Razer typically uses panels with low response times often 3ms or less to minimize ghosting and motion blur in fast-moving scenes.

Color Accuracy and Brightness

Beyond refresh rate, the display excels in color reproduction and brightness, making it suitable for content creation.

  • Vibrant Colors: The panel covers 100% of the DCI-P3 color gamut, a professional-grade standard, meaning it can display a wide range of vivid and accurate colors. This is vital for tasks like photo editing, video editing, and graphic design.
  • Brightness: Typical peak brightness is around 500 nits, which is more than sufficient for most indoor environments and even some outdoor use, though direct sunlight can still be challenging. The high brightness also helps content pop and improves HDR High Dynamic Range viewing experiences where supported.
  • Contrast Ratio: IPS panels generally offer good contrast, and the Blade 14’s display is no exception, providing deep blacks and bright whites, enhancing visual depth.

Adaptive Sync Technologies

The inclusion of adaptive sync technology is a significant benefit for gamers.

  • AMD FreeSync Premium: The Blade 14 2023 supports AMD FreeSync Premium, which synchronizes the display’s refresh rate with the GPU’s frame rate. This eliminates screen tearing and minimizes stuttering, resulting in a much smoother and more enjoyable gaming experience, especially when frame rates fluctuate.
  • Optimized Gaming: This technology is particularly valuable in graphically demanding games where maintaining a constant 240 FPS might not always be possible, ensuring a consistent visual flow.

Performance Powerhouse: Unleashing AMD and NVIDIA

The Razer Blade 14 2023 combines AMD’s latest Ryzen processors with NVIDIA’s RTX 40-series GPUs, delivering exceptional performance in a compact footprint.

This synergistic pairing makes it a formidable machine for both gaming and demanding creative workloads.

Processor: AMD Ryzen 9 7940HS

At the heart of the Blade 14 2023 is the AMD Ryzen 9 7940HS.

This is a powerful 8-core, 16-thread processor built on the Zen 4 architecture, offering impressive multi-core performance for productivity and content creation, alongside strong single-core speeds for gaming.

  • Core Configuration: 8 Cores / 16 Threads provide ample processing power for multitasking, video rendering, and compilation tasks.
  • Boost Clock Speed: Capable of boosting up to 5.2 GHz, ensuring quick responsiveness in applications and high frame rates in games that rely on single-core performance.
  • Integrated Graphics: Features AMD Radeon 780M integrated graphics, which is surprisingly capable for light gaming and greatly assists in power efficiency when the dedicated GPU isn’t needed. This allows for longer battery life during casual use.
  • Efficiency: The “HS” designation indicates a processor designed for thin and light gaming laptops, balancing performance with thermal efficiency.

Graphics Card: NVIDIA GeForce RTX 40 Series

The GPU is arguably the most critical component for a gaming laptop, and the Blade 14 2023 doesn’t disappoint, offering options up to the NVIDIA GeForce RTX 4070 Laptop GPU. Cherry Stream Keyboard Review

  • RTX 4060/4070 Options: The Blade 14 comes with either the RTX 4060 Laptop GPU or the more powerful RTX 4070 Laptop GPU. Both are built on NVIDIA’s Ada Lovelace architecture, offering significant improvements over previous generations in terms of raw performance and efficiency.
  • DLSS 3 with Frame Generation: A game-changer for performance. DLSS 3 utilizes AI to upscale lower-resolution images and, more importantly, generates entirely new frames between traditionally rendered frames. This can dramatically boost frame rates in supported titles, allowing you to hit higher refresh rates or play at higher settings.
  • Ray Tracing Capabilities: The RTX 40 series GPUs feature dedicated RT Cores for accelerated ray tracing, enabling more realistic lighting, shadows, and reflections in games that support the technology. While ray tracing is demanding, DLSS 3 helps make it more playable.
  • TGP Total Graphics Power: Razer configures the RTX 4070 in the Blade 14 with a TGP of up to 140W with Dynamic Boost, which is a healthy power limit for a 14-inch chassis, allowing the GPU to perform near its full potential.

Thermals and Fan Noise: Managing the Heat

Packing high-performance components into a thin chassis is always a balancing act, and the Razer Blade 14 2023 employs a sophisticated cooling system to manage the heat generated by the Ryzen 9 processor and RTX 40-series GPU.

Cooling System Design

Razer utilizes a custom vapor chamber cooling system, which is a more advanced and efficient cooling solution compared to traditional heat pipes, especially in thin form factors.

  • Vapor Chamber: This system uses a sealed chamber containing a small amount of liquid that vaporizes when heated by the components, carrying heat away efficiently. The vapor then condenses back into liquid as it cools, repeating the cycle.
  • Dual Fan Setup: Two high-performance fans draw in cool air and exhaust hot air through strategically placed vents, including rear and side vents.
  • Heat Spreader and Fins: Extensive heat fins and spreaders are integrated to maximize the surface area for heat dissipation.

Thermal Performance Under Load

Under heavy gaming or productivity loads, the Blade 14’s components will generate significant heat.

Razer’s cooling system does an admirable job of keeping temperatures within acceptable limits, though performance will fluctuate slightly based on the selected power profile.

  • CPU Temperatures: During sustained gaming, the Ryzen 9 7940HS can reach temperatures in the high 80s to low 90s Celsius. While these numbers might seem high, they are within AMD’s operating specifications for Ryzen processors, which are designed to run hot and maximize performance within thermal limits.
  • GPU Temperatures: The RTX 4070 typically runs cooler than the CPU, often in the 70s Celsius range during gaming, thanks to efficient power delivery and the vapor chamber.
  • Surface Temperatures: The keyboard deck generally remains comfortable for typing, though the area directly above the keyboard and towards the rear of the chassis can become warm under intense load. The bottom of the laptop will naturally get quite hot.

Fan Noise Characteristics

This is often the primary trade-off for a thin and powerful gaming laptop.

The Blade 14’s fans can become quite audible when the system is pushed to its limits.

  • Idle/Light Use: In quiet mode or during light tasks like web browsing or video streaming, the fans are virtually silent or run at a very low, unobtrusive hum.
  • Gaming/Heavy Workloads: When playing demanding games or running CPU/GPU intensive applications, the fans ramp up significantly. The noise profile is typically a consistent whoosh, which can be less annoying than a high-pitched whine, but it’s definitely noticeable.
  • Headphones Recommended: For an immersive gaming experience, using gaming headphones is highly recommended to drown out fan noise and fully enjoy the audio.
  • Razer Synapse Profiles: Razer Synapse software allows users to select different performance profiles e.g., Silent, Balanced, Custom, Boost.
    • Silent Mode: Reduces fan noise at the expense of some performance, suitable for light tasks.
    • Balanced Mode: A good compromise for everyday use and less demanding games.
    • Boost/Custom Mode: Unlocks maximum performance and pushes the fans to their limits, ideal for competitive gaming. Users can also create custom fan curves for more granular control.

Connectivity: Port Selection and Wireless Capabilities

A well-rounded set of ports is crucial for a modern laptop, especially one aimed at power users and gamers.

The Razer Blade 14 2023 offers a solid selection of connectivity options, balancing modern standards with legacy ports. Hisense 65 Inch U6 Series Uled Tv 65U6K Review

Wired Ports

The port selection is designed to be versatile, allowing users to connect various peripherals, external displays, and storage devices without excessive dongles.

  • Right Side:
    • USB 3.2 Gen 2 Type-A port: For connecting standard USB peripherals like mice, keyboards, or external drives.
    • USB 3.2 Gen 2 Type-C port DisplayPort 1.4, Power Delivery 3.0: Versatile for connecting external displays, high-speed storage, and even charging the laptop with a compatible USB-C PD charger though for full performance, the dedicated power adapter is needed.
    • HDMI 2.1 port: Essential for connecting to high-resolution, high-refresh-rate external monitors and TVs. Supports up to 4K 120Hz or 1080p 360Hz.
    • Kensington Lock: For physical security.
  • Left Side:
    • Power Port: For the proprietary barrel jack power adapter.
    • USB 4 Type-C port DisplayPort 1.4, Power Delivery 3.0: Offering higher bandwidth than standard USB 3.2 Type-C, capable of supporting more demanding external devices and display setups. Being USB 4, it also means it’s compatible with Thunderbolt 3/4 devices, expanding peripheral options.
    • USB 3.2 Gen 2 Type-A port: Another standard USB-A port for flexibility.
    • 3.5mm Headphone/Microphone Combo Jack: For audio peripherals, which is a welcome inclusion as many thin laptops omit this.

Wireless Connectivity

Staying connected with the latest wireless standards is just as important as wired options, and the Blade 14 2023 integrates cutting-edge technologies.

  • Wi-Fi 6E 802.11ax: This is the latest Wi-Fi standard at the time of release, offering several advantages over previous generations:
    • Faster Speeds: Theoretically capable of multi-gigabit speeds, significantly improving download and upload times, especially with compatible Wi-Fi 6E routers.
    • Reduced Latency: Crucial for online gaming, providing a more stable and responsive connection.
    • Less Congestion: Wi-Fi 6E utilizes the 6GHz band, which is far less congested than the 2.4GHz and 5GHz bands, leading to better performance in busy network environments.
  • Bluetooth 5.2: Provides reliable and efficient connectivity for wireless peripherals like headphones, mice, and game controllers. Bluetooth 5.2 offers improved range, speed, and energy efficiency compared to older versions.

Considerations

  • No Ethernet Port: Due to its thin profile, the Blade 14 lacks a built-in Ethernet port. For competitive online gaming where a wired connection is preferred, you’ll need a USB-C to Ethernet adapter.
  • SD Card Reader: There is no integrated SD card reader, which might be a minor inconvenience for photographers or videographers who frequently transfer media from cameras. A USB-C SD card reader would be necessary.

Overall, the Razer Blade 14 2023 offers a robust and modern port selection, particularly with the inclusion of USB 4 and HDMI 2.1, alongside the latest Wi-Fi 6E and Bluetooth 5.2. While the absence of an Ethernet port and SD card reader are minor points, they are easily remedied with external adapters, and the overall connectivity suite is excellent for a laptop of its size.

Battery Life: Portability Meets Endurance

For a gaming laptop, especially a compact one, battery life is often a significant concern.

The Razer Blade 14 2023, thanks in part to its AMD processor and NVIDIA’s efficiency improvements, delivers surprisingly decent endurance for its class.

Battery Capacity

The Blade 14 2023 houses a 68.1 WHr lithium-ion polymer battery.

This is a respectable capacity for a 14-inch form factor and contributes to its ability to last through a workday without needing a constant power outlet.

Real-World Usage Scenarios

Battery life will vary dramatically depending on the workload.

  • Light Use Web Browsing, Video Streaming, Document Editing: Expect to get around 6 to 8 hours of battery life. This is achievable by:
    • Setting the display brightness to around 50-60%.
    • Enabling power-saving modes in Windows and Razer Synapse e.g., “Silent” or “Balanced” performance profile.
    • Relying on the AMD integrated graphics AMD Radeon 780M for non-demanding tasks, as the NVIDIA GPU will remain in a low-power state.
    • Closing unnecessary background applications.
  • Moderate Use Light Gaming, Creative Tasks, Software Development: Battery life will drop to around 2 to 4 hours. The dedicated GPU will engage more frequently, consuming more power.
  • Heavy Gaming Demanding Titles with Dedicated GPU: Under intense gaming loads, battery life will be significantly shorter, typically ranging from 1 to 1.5 hours. It’s highly recommended to keep the laptop plugged in during gaming sessions to ensure maximum performance and avoid battery drain. When on battery, the system often limits GPU power to conserve energy, resulting in reduced frame rates.

Factors Influencing Battery Life

  • CPU and GPU Usage: The more intensive the task, the more power consumed. The dedicated NVIDIA GPU is the primary power hog.
  • Display Brightness: Higher brightness levels consume more power.
  • Refresh Rate: While the display is 240Hz, it will dynamically adjust to lower refresh rates e.g., 60Hz or 120Hz for static content or when on battery to conserve power. However, forcing it to stay at 240Hz will reduce battery life.
  • Keyboard Backlighting: The per-key RGB lighting, while beautiful, does consume power. Dimming or turning it off can slightly extend battery life.
  • Wireless Connectivity: Constant Wi-Fi and Bluetooth usage will drain the battery faster.
  • Power Profiles: Razer Synapse’s performance profiles significantly impact battery life by controlling CPU/GPU power limits and fan speeds.

Charging

The Blade 14 comes with a proprietary power adapter, typically 230W, for full performance and rapid charging.

It also supports USB-C Power Delivery PD up to 100W, which is convenient for slower charging on the go with a universal USB-C charger, though it won’t be enough to sustain peak performance during gaming.

For a gaming laptop, the Blade 14’s battery life is commendably good for productivity and casual use, making it a genuinely portable machine.

However, as with all high-performance laptops, you’ll still need to be near a power outlet for extended gaming sessions to get the best experience.

Upgradeability and Value Proposition

When investing in a premium gaming laptop like the Razer Blade 14 2023, considering its long-term value, upgrade potential, and overall cost-effectiveness is crucial.

Upgradeability

  • RAM: The RAM on the Razer Blade 14 2023 is soldered to the motherboard. This means you cannot upgrade the memory after purchase. It’s vital to choose a configuration e.g., 16GB or 32GB that meets your anticipated needs for the lifespan of the laptop. For most power users and gamers, 16GB is the minimum, but 32GB offers better future-proofing, especially for demanding creative work or heavy multitasking.
  • Storage SSD: This is the one user-upgradeable component. The Blade 14 typically comes with a single M.2 NVMe PCIe Gen4 SSD.
    • Single Slot: There is usually only one M.2 slot, so if you want more storage, you’ll need to replace the existing drive with a higher-capacity one.
    • Ease of Access: Accessing the SSD typically involves removing the bottom panel of the laptop, which is generally straightforward for those comfortable with basic laptop maintenance.
    • Future-Proofing: While it supports PCIe Gen4, as newer Gen5 drives become more prevalent, the Gen4 slot will still offer excellent performance for years to come.
  • Battery: While technically replaceable, replacing the battery often requires opening the chassis and can be a more involved process. It’s usually something done for maintenance rather than an upgrade.
  • Wi-Fi Card: The Wi-Fi module is typically soldered as well, meaning you cannot upgrade it to a newer standard in the future. However, Wi-Fi 6E is already cutting-edge, so this is less of a concern.

Key Takeaway on Upgradeability: Prioritize the RAM configuration at purchase. If you need more storage down the line, a single SSD replacement is your primary option.
